An Advanced Certificate in Cultural Heritage Destination Development equips professionals with the skills to revitalize and sustainably manage cultural tourism destinations. This program focuses on developing practical expertise in heritage site management and community engagement.
Learning outcomes include mastering heritage tourism planning, developing effective marketing strategies, understanding cultural sensitivity in tourism development, and implementing sustainable tourism practices. Graduates will be capable of conducting heritage impact assessments and crafting compelling narratives around cultural heritage.
The duration of the Advanced Certificate in Cultural Heritage Destination Development typically ranges from six months to a year, depending on the institution and program structure. This intensive program is designed to accelerate career advancement in the field.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ance, catering to the growing demand for skilled professionals in the cultural tourism sector. Graduates are prepared for roles such as heritage site managers, tourism consultants, and cultural resource specialists. The program directly addresses the needs of heritage organizations, government agencies, and private tourism companies seeking expertise in sustainable heritage tourism.
The program integrates theoretical knowledge with practical applications, often involving case studies, site visits, and hands-on project work. This ensures that graduates possess the necessary skills and experience to contribute immediately to their chosen field, promoting responsible cultural heritage tourism and destination management.

An Advanced Certificate in Cultural Heritage Destination Development is increasingly significant in today's competitive tourism market. The UK's cultural heritage sector contributes substantially to the economy, with recent data highlighting its importance. The UK boasts over 20,000 heritage sites, attracting millions of visitors annually, and generating billions in revenue. This booming sector demands professionals skilled in sustainable tourism management, heritage conservation, and community engagement. This certificate equips individuals with the necessary expertise to thrive in this field. This includes understanding destination management, marketing strategies, and the intricacies of preserving cultural assets. According to VisitBritain, inbound tourism contributed £28.4 billion to the UK economy in 2019. The post-pandemic recovery necessitates individuals trained in revitalizing heritage sites to attract tourists safely and responsibly.
